WebJan 14, 2005 · The floating diffusion region of a pixel is an important structure. Currently, the floating diffusion region is formed as an N+ implant in a semiconductor substrate. This enables the use of standard transistors which are adjacent to this floating diffusion (such as the transfer transistor and reset transistor). Webambipolar diffusion zThere is a small E field which keeps the excess holes and electrons together. zThe ambipolar diffusion constant for minority carriers comes out to be the diffusion constant for the other, majority carriers, in the cases where the majority carriers greatly outnumber the minority carriers.
